What Are New No Limit Casinos?

New no limit casinos are recently launched platforms that advertise wider betting flexibility, larger maximum win potential, and fewer restrictive caps on bonus conversion or game stakes. In practice, “no limit” rarely means absolutely unlimited play; it usually means higher practical ceilings than older sites. As of April 2026, German players are increasingly searching for platforms that combine this flexibility with fast payments and transparent terms.

Always read the bonus terms before depositing. A casino can market itself as “no limit” while still applying wagering multipliers, game contribution rules, and maximum cashout limits on promotional funds.

Bonus Value, Limits, and Wagering Explained

Why headline bonuses can be misleading

A 500% or 520% offer can look unbeatable, but the real value depends on contribution rates, maximum bet rules while wagering, and eligible game categories. Slots often contribute 100%, while table games may contribute less or not at all. This is why we compare total package structure, not just the top number in the banner.

German Regulatory Reality Behind “No Limit” Claims

In Germany, the phrase “no limit casino” can be misunderstood. Depending on licensing model, product category, and operator policy, practical limits may still exist at account, transaction, or game level. Players should distinguish between marketing language and enforceable terms. A casino may allow high deposits but still apply withdrawal batching, enhanced due diligence checks, or provider-level max-bet restrictions during bonus play. The safest approach is to read the cashier limits, bonus terms, and responsible gaming settings before depositing. If limits are not clearly visible pre-registration, that is already a transparency issue. In a compliant environment, clear controls are not a weakness; they are a sign of a serious operator.

German players should always verify whether winnings are taxed at source through game mechanics or operator obligations in specific products. Tax treatment can differ by vertical and jurisdictional setup, so relying on a generic “tax-free” claim is risky.

KYC and Source-of-Funds: Why New Casinos Ask More Questions

Many players see verification as friction, but for new no limit casinos it is often the key process that determines whether withdrawals are smooth later. Strong KYC at onboarding reduces fraud risk and helps prevent account freezes after a big win. In Germany-focused operations, you may be asked for identity, address, payment ownership, and occasionally source-of-funds evidence if transaction patterns are high or unusual. The best operators communicate this early, provide secure upload channels, and review documents within stated timelines. Poor operators delay checks until withdrawal and then request documents in multiple rounds. If a casino explains verification triggers clearly and publishes review times, that is usually a positive trust signal.

Good practice: Complete verification before your first large deposit. It protects your bankroll from avoidable payout delays and gives you a clearer picture of the operator’s service quality.

What “No Limit” Usually Means in Practice

In most cases, “no limit” refers to fewer restrictions compared with highly capped environments, not the complete absence of limits. You may still encounter per-transaction ceilings, daily risk controls, or provider-level bet caps on specific slots and tables. Some casinos are “no limit” on deposits but conservative on withdrawals; others are flexible for verified VIP users only. The key is to map limits across the full player journey: deposit, wagering, bonus use, and cashout. When that map is transparent, you can make an informed choice. When it is hidden behind generic marketing, move on.

Limit TypeWhere It AppearsImpact on PlayerHow to Check
Deposit LimitCashier settings or account controlsDefines funding flexibility and risk exposureReview cashier + responsible gaming page
Bet LimitGame provider rules and bonus termsAffects strategy and wagering eligibilityOpen game info + bonus T&Cs
Withdrawal LimitCashier and termsDetermines payout timeline for larger winsCheck daily/weekly/monthly caps
Verification ThresholdCompliance policyCan pause withdrawals if unmetRead KYC/AML section before deposit

RTP vs Volatility: A Player-Friendly Interpretation

ConceptWhat It Tells YouWhat It Does NOT Tell YouBest Use Case
RTP (Return to Player)Long-term theoretical payback percentageShort-session outcomes or guaranteed returnsComparing similar games over time
Volatility (Variance)How wins are distributed (frequent small vs rare large)Whether a game is “better” in absolute termsMatching game behavior to bankroll tolerance
Hit FrequencyHow often winning events occurTotal profitability or bonus suitabilityChoosing smoother entertainment sessions

Responsible Gambling Tools That Actually Work in Practice

Not all responsible gambling features are equally useful. The most effective tools are those that are easy to activate instantly, difficult to reverse impulsively, and clearly explained during onboarding. Deposit limits help with budget control, but session reminders and cooling-off periods are often better for players who struggle with time awareness rather than spending caps alone. Self-exclusion should include clear duration options and transparent reactivation rules. Strong casinos present these tools as core account settings, not as hidden links in policy pages.

ToolBest use caseWhat to look for
Deposit limitMonthly bankroll planningImmediate decrease, delayed increase
Loss limitControl downside in volatile sessionsSimple dashboard tracking
Session timerTime managementAutomatic pop-up reminders
Cooling-offShort reset after heavy playOne-click activation, no loopholes
Self-exclusionSerious harm preventionClear duration and support referral links

Bonus Engineering: Turning Big Numbers into Real Value

A bonus should be evaluated like a financial offer, not a headline. Start with bonus amount and wagering multiple, then adjust for game contribution and any maximum cashout cap. A smaller bonus with fair contribution and no restrictive cap can be worth more than a larger package that is difficult to clear. Time limits also matter: short validity windows increase pressure and can push poor decision-making. For no-limit players, flexibility in eligible stakes during wagering is another key variable, as some casinos quietly limit bet size while bonus funds are active.

Bonus typePotential upsideHidden friction point
Matched depositPredictable bankroll boostHigh wagering multiple
Free spins bundleLow-entry value explorationLow max conversion to cash
Reload offersOngoing value for regular playersFrequent opt-in deadlines
CashbackVariance smoothingNet-loss calculation exclusions

Wagering Math in Plain Language

If a player receives €200 bonus with 35x wagering, total required turnover is €7,000. But that headline number is only part of the story. If your preferred games contribute 20% instead of 100%, effective turnover requirement rises dramatically in practical terms. Add a max bet rule during wagering, and the path to completion becomes slower and more restrictive. This is why experienced players compare not just “x-times” but the full rule set before claiming.

Quick formula: Effective effort = Bonus × Wagering ÷ Game contribution. Lower effort usually means better real bonus value.

KYC Stages and What Triggers Extra Checks

StageTypical requirementCommon trigger for delay
Basic identityID document + profile matchBlurry upload or expired ID
Address proofRecent utility/bank statementDocument older than allowed window
Payment verificationMethod ownership confirmationName mismatch across accounts
Enhanced reviewSource-of-funds evidenceLarge or unusual transaction pattern
